Come identificare le proprietà di campioni finiti

February 12

Come identificare le proprietà di campioni finiti


I computer leggere il codice per identificare il testo e di elaborazione delle informazioni. Software progettisti stringa pezzi di codice insieme per creare programmi. Ogni pezzo di codice rappresenta un potenziale numero di stati. Le possibilità di codifica sono infinite, ma i potenziali stati di un codice stabilito sono finite.

macchine a stati finiti identificare le proprietà di stati finiti. Una macchina a stati finiti è un principio matematico in grado di identificare le proprietà finite di codice computer. Essi hanno un valore inestimabile nella ricerca di potenziali problemi e le soluzioni in codice binario, HTML e altre forme di codifica e della meccanica.

istruzione

1 Identificare lo stato di partenza. Questo è il primo evento nel codice. Nel codice binario, questo sarebbe espressa come numero 1 o 0.

2 Come identificare le proprietà di campioni finiti

Gli stati finiti sono le possibilità tra l'inizio e la fine del codice.

Identificare lo stato accettare. Questo è l'ultimo evento nel codice. Le proprietà di stati finiti sono espressi come i singoli eventi tra l'inizio e di accettare gli stati e il loro esito collettiva. Lo stato iniziale e lo stato di accettare sono sempre statici. Essi rimangono gli stessi, mentre il codice tra loro è delineata in una varietà di modi.

3 Identificare i potenziali stati nel codice. Poiché i computer leggono il codice in una direzione lineare, un insieme di codici computer può essere espresso in vari modi, o stati finiti. Ad esempio, un insieme di codice con il numero 0 e il numero 1 ha due stati finiti. Questo insieme può essere espresso come 01 o 10. I codici sono in genere molto più grande di questo. Utilizzare un diagramma per descrivere gli stati potenziali o usare la matematica probabilità di generare un elenco.

4 Identificare le transizioni nel codice. Codice viene letto come una sequenza di eventi. Ogni sequenza richiede un numero di passaggi per raggiungere un risultato di programmazione. Ognuno di questi passaggi è una transizione. Isolando le transizioni degli stati finiti, è possibile visualizzare i singoli aspetti del codice. Ciò consente di isolare eventuali problemi specifici. Durante la generazione o la valutazione di codice, è possibile riorganizzare le singole transizioni per produrre stati diversi.

5 Come identificare le proprietà di campioni finiti

L'uscita è il risultato di lettura del codice a stati finiti. Un'immagine può essere reso da pixel, per esempio.

Identificare l'uscita del codice. Questo è lo stato finale del codice. Seguendo una sequenza di transizioni in un modello definito da stato iniziale di accettare lo stato, si produrrà un risultato. Ogni stati finiti produce un risultato diverso. Questo è l'uscita. E 'l'espressione finale di codice che si traduce in informazioni di testo o la trasformazione.